Dealer's description

Built for one purpose to go fast. This rare 1968 Chevrolet Camaro is a fully sorted, purpose-built drag car capable of 8-second passes, combining brutal big block power with a professionally built drivetrain and race-proven setup. Powered by a 468ci Big Block Chevrolet with 13:1 compression running on E85, paired to a TH400 transmission built by Lizard Transmissions and rated for up to 2,000 horsepower, this Camaro delivers serious performance without compromise.The car features a back-half conversion with a Dana 60 rear end, 3.56 gears, big tire setup, drag radial configuration, and a Lenko Lightning Rod shifter from Kilduff for an authentic race experience. Recently refreshed electrical and fuel systems include Teflon fuel lines, an Aeromotive A1000 fuel pump, and an E85 carburetor for reliability under high load.Inside, the cabin is all business with dual 17 Kirkey racing seats, brand new racing harnesses, and a full roll cage safety system. Mechanically, the vehicle is reported to be in excellent condition and ready for the strip.A rare opportunity to own an extremely capable, professionally built 1968 Camaro drag car with proven performance, serious hardware, and the potential to compete at the highest level.
